Design and optimisation of novel Huperzine A analogues capable of modulating the acetylcholinesterase receptor for the management of Alzheimer’s disease
This is a de novo drug design study that aimed to create novel structures based on the alkaloid Huperzine A, capable of inhibiting the acetylcholinesterase (AChE) enzyme ligand binding pocket (AChE_LBP) for the management of Alzheimer’s disease. The X-ray crystallographic model of the Torpedo Californica AChE complexed to Huperzine A was identified from the Protein Data Bank (PDB ID 1VOT). Molecular visualisation...

Analysis of bioactive chemical compounds of Euphorbia lathyrus using gas chromatography-mass spectrometry and Fourier-transform infrared spectroscopy
The aim of this study was determination the phytochemical composition of methanolic seeds extract of Euphorbia lathyrus. G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S) analysis of E. lathyrus revealed the existence of the Carbonic acid, (ethyl)(1,2,4-triazol-1-ylmethyl) diester, 1H-Pyrrole,2,5-dihydro-1-nitroso, Hexanal dimethyl acetal, Isosorbide dinitrate, DL-Arabinose,...
